Hey guys/gals. Got a Cisco SPA504g sip phone registered to a 7200 v 4.53c. I can make internal calls as well as outbound calls. Works great. I don't know the pros/cons of non samsung SIP stations ie button prog, call forwarding, etc... MWI's work on the phone, but not the cfna to 5039 get a "forbidden" message. So one question is - Does CFNA and/or DND work on a SIP Station. Also, is there anyway to program buttons on the SIP Station. I can't find anything in either the Samsung manual or the Cisco manual, so here I am. Thanks for any responses.

Sip stations are generally programmed via a web interface directly onto the handset.

Ie - if you sip phone ip is 10.1.1.1 then you browse to that in your web browser and configure it.

I have used yealink phones and the park function in the phone works on a OS7200 4.4x
